I'm a school nurse (new role for me) at an American International School in Dhaka, Bangladesh. We have a gardener with Hep B and many of his fellow workers are concerned, as well as the school superintendent. He has his own eating utensils but it just came to my attention that he drinks from the water points around school. How concerned should the school be? All the overseas hired teachers have Hep B vaccinations but not all the locally hired teachers. It is also recommended that the students have Hep B immunizations but not required. This is a country where probably over 10% of the population has Hep B. What do you recommend? We also have a bus monitor and receptionist (dual job) person with Hep B.

from water fountains?...isn't that stretching it a little too far...just a thought. the stigmas it can cause, maybe a training for ur house staff on transmission routes instead.

If a water point is a water fountain I agree with the previous poster that there is no risk. But if a water point is communal bucket of water like it is in some communities. He will need to use his own glass and there should be a serving ladle that no one drinks from.

Please clarify what do you mean by a water point.

Sorry, water fountain. The guy's buddies and management was getting a little jumpy, but I got everyone calmed down. His fellow workers were really concerned about tea time but we got the guy his own eating/drinking utensils and taught him some precautions for work and to protect his family.
